Lazio President Claudio Lotito responded angrily to the fan boycott that left the Stadio Olimpico virtually empty in opposition to Lecce. ‘I don’t settle for intimidation.’

This was meant to be an enormous event on the Stadio Olimpico, particularly because it represented the debut of the brand new eagle mascot, named Flaminia, after the well-known issues across the earlier mascot and handler.
Nevertheless, there have been only a few folks there to see it fly across the area, due to a protest organised by the Curva Nord ultras.
Lazio followers abandon the Olympic Stadium in protest

This was as a result of ostensibly the followers wished to ask the grand-daughter of Vincenzo Paparelli to the centre circle to view a tifo in his honour.
Paparelli was a 33-year-old Lazio fan who was killed through the derby in October 1979 when a firework launched from the Roma supporters struck him.
In line with the ultras, the membership banned them from inviting her and likewise didn’t approve the choreography.
Lazio insist the matter has been twisted, and that these followers went by way of the mistaken channels to get the banners permitted.

President Lotito spoke to Sky Sport Italia forward of kick-off and additional defined his view of the scenario.
“I believe followers should be followers, respectful of the principles, and provides constructive criticism so we will all work collectively to realize outcomes,” stated the patron.
“This strike was constructed upon an preliminary premise that was fully false. They stated that we denied Paparelli’s grand daughter the chance to be on the pitch. It’s completely false.
“The actual downside is that there have been 4 representatives of the ultras who wished to be on the pitch and we thought-about it inopportune in gentle of the final scenario.
“We revered, honoured and welcomed Paparelli’s household to the VIP part of the stadium. That is simply being twisted to hunt a job that doesn’t exist within the rapport between followers and membership.
“The followers should be followers and respect the membership. If folks use this case to coerce others into backing them, then I can’t stand for it, and I don’t settle for intimidation.
“People who find themselves stopping followers from coming to look at Lazio are usually not actual followers, they’re doing it for their very own ends.”
